Output deb4b21592ed47ae86c1b54c33913a0ff49963d9f13fb7f60c872e7654e8597d:1

value
15640616391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9554075e18005f3d1854aa88c273294834adcf34 OP_EQUALVERIFY OP_CHECKSIG
address
1EcaM1GmWC8kUCFfiFj9V6Ct5ykRW33KmU
transaction
deb4b21592ed47ae86c1b54c33913a0ff49963d9f13fb7f60c872e7654e8597d
confirmations
683929
spent
true